Sorry if this doesn't belong here but I'm now the proud owner of an MY99 GC8 WRX and I just have to show it off.
Details are: 2.0L 4cyl 16v DOHC Turbo. 5sp manual, AWD - stock standard thing of beauty.
The paint is immaculate, it's the 74F Prodrive, 22B Rally blue colour with sunroof and 195,xxxkm on the ODO.

I was also recently informed that you should make sure all 4 tyres are the same...a friend of a workmate put 2 tyres on the front and different tyres on the rear about a month later and cooked and killed the centre diff...don't know if that was a newer one that what you have or not
